| The normal time for completion of a combined program is five years for full-time pass students. The length of the combined program makes part-time study inadvisable and the Colleges will examine such applications carefully. This combined program will be offered for the first time in 2011. |

Admission Requirements
These are only a guide for admission. Exact entry level will be set at time of offer.
| Entry Requirement | Entry Level | | UAI / ENTER / TER | 95 | | QLD Band | 4 | | International Baccalaureate | 36 |
The UAI will be referred to as ATAR (Australian Tertiary Admission Rank) for admission in 2010. See http://www.uac.edu.au/undergraduate/atar/ for further information.
Queensland Band equivalents are a guide only - selection is made on a UAI equivalent that is not available to students. The University reserves the right to alter or discontinue its programs as required.
The Entry Requirements above refer ONLY to admission for Australian and Australian Permanent Resident undergraduate applicants. Please view further information on Entry Requirements for International Undergraduate Applicants. | | | Prerequisites
You must satisfy the prerequisites for both degrees. |
